According to reports from the BBC, a gas explosion occurred at the Liushenyu mine in China, resulting in at least 82 fatalities. The incident is described as the country's worst mining disaster in more than a decade. The explosion underscores persistent safety challenges in China's coal mining industry, despite years of efforts to improve oversight and reduce accident rates. Authorities have launched an investigation into the cause of the explosion, and rescue operations have been initiated. The mine's operator, specific location details, and the exact timeline of the event have not been publicly disclosed beyond the initial reporting. The disaster comes as China continues to balance its reliance on coal for energy security with increasing demands for workplace safety and environmental compliance. Past mining accidents in the region have often led to temporary shutdowns, safety audits, and stricter enforcement of existing regulations. The Liushenyu mine explosion is likely to draw renewed scrutiny from both domestic regulators and international observers. Key takeaways from the incident center on the potential for heightened regulatory oversight of China's mining sector. The disaster may prompt the government to accelerate safety inspections and impose more stringent penalties for non-compliance. This could translate into temporary production halts at similar underground coal mines, particularly those with outdated equipment or inadequate ventilation systems. Historically, major mining accidents in China have led to industry-wide safety campaigns and, in some cases, the closure of unsafe mines. For coal producers, such regulatory tightening could disrupt supply chains and affect output levels in the near term. Additionally, the incident may influence investor sentiment toward companies with exposure to coal mining operations, especially those with a track record of safety violations. However, the broader impact on China's overall coal production would likely be limited if the affected mine is not a major contributor. The disaster also highlights the ongoing tension between maintaining coal-dependent energy infrastructure and improving worker safety standards. From an investment perspective, the Liushenyu mine explosion could increase scrutiny on mining companies' operational safety practices and regulatory compliance costs. Investors may consider evaluating their exposure to coal mining equities amid potential short-term volatility. The incident might also accelerate calls for a transition to cleaner energy sources, as safety risks associated with underground coal mining remain a persistent concern. However, given China's energy needs and the essential role of coal in its power generation, any abrupt policy shift is unlikely. The economic implications of the disaster will depend on the scale of any government-mandated shutdowns or safety reviews. If extended, such measures could tighten regional coal supply and support coal prices, although this effect would likely be muted by existing inventories. Overall, the disaster serves as a reminder of the systemic risks in the mining sector and the importance of monitoring regulatory developments.
